There's no single story of motherhood, but I've gathered several of my favorites that highlight some of the diverse experiences of motherhood. 🫶
In the Family Way by Laney Katz Becker - An emotional, thoughtful, and ultimately hopeful historical fiction novel about a group of suburban women set in 1965.
The Last Hour Between Worlds by Melissa Caruso - A sweeping fantasy with sapphic love, captivating magic, and exhilarating time loops.
Weyward by Emilia Hart - A raw, powerful historical fiction novel—with a pinch of witchy magic—following three women spanning five centuries.
The Supper Club Saints by Claire Swinarski - A creative, lyrical novel set in small-town Wisconsin.
Only Spell Deep by Ava Morgyn - A dark, atmospheric, sea-swept urban fantasy infused with horror and magic.
Lady Tremaine by Rachel Hochhauser - A brilliant, sharp, and sweeping reimagining of Cinderella, told from the "evil" stepmother's perspective.
The Last Mandarin by Louise Penny and Mellissa Fung - A gripping, cinematic thriller with doses of mystery, intrigue, and politics.
The Manor of Dreams by Christina Li - A twisty, haunting gothic thriller with sapphic love, family drama, and a haunted garden.
We Don’t Talk About Carol by Kristen L. Berry - A gripping, sharp suspense novel brimming with family drama, mystery, and love.
A Founding Mother by Laura Kamoie and Stephanie Dray - A fierce, powerful, captivating historical fiction novel following Abigail Adams.
